在动作客户端和控制器之间使用动作服务器有以下好处:
- 分担客户端负载:动作服务器可以处理客户端发送的请求,减轻客户端的负载压力。客户端只需发送请求并接收响应,而不需要执行复杂的计算任务,提高了客户端的性能和响应速度。
- 提高系统的可扩展性:通过引入动作服务器,可以将系统的计算和处理能力分布到多个服务器上,实现系统的横向扩展。当系统负载增加时,可以简单地增加动作服务器的数量,以满足更多的请求,提高系统的可扩展性。
- 实现业务逻辑的集中管理:动作服务器可以作为业务逻辑的中心,集中管理和处理各种请求。通过将业务逻辑集中在动作服务器上,可以更好地维护和管理系统的功能,减少代码重复和冗余。
- 提高系统的安全性:动作服务器可以作为安全防护层,对客户端请求进行验证和过滤,确保只有合法的请求能够访问系统。通过动作服务器的安全控制,可以有效防止恶意攻击和非法访问。
- 支持跨平台和跨设备的开发:动作服务器可以提供统一的接口和协议,使得不同平台和设备的客户端可以通过相同的方式与服务器进行通信。这样可以简化开发过程,提高开发效率,并支持多平台和多设备的互操作性。
腾讯云相关产品推荐: